Cannot deconstruct dynamic objects

WebFeb 28, 2024 · Similarly, you cannot declare a formal parameter of a method, property, constructor, or indexer as having an anonymous type. To pass an anonymous type, or a collection that contains anonymous types, as an argument to a method, you can declare the parameter as type object. However, using object for anonymous types defeats the … WebJan 27, 2024 · If the destructured object doesn't have the property specified in the destructuring assignment, then the variable is assigned with undefined. Let's see how it …

Using ES6 To Destructure Deeply Nested Objects in …

WebIl libro “Moneta, rivoluzione e filosofia dell’avvenire. Nietzsche e la politica accelerazionista in Deleuze, Foucault, Guattari, Klossowski” prende le mosse da un oscuro frammento di Nietzsche - I forti dell’avvenire - incastonato nel celebre passaggio dell’“accelerare il processo” situato nel punto cruciale di una delle opere filosofiche più dirompenti del … WebA dynamic object created via p = new Foo is destroyed via delete p. If you forget to delete p, you have a resource leak. You should never attempt to do one of the following, since they all lead to undefined behavior: destroy a dynamic object via delete [] (note the square brackets), free or any other means destroy a dynamic object multiple times smallest towns in tennessee https://amazeswedding.com

Destructuring assignment - JavaScript MDN - Mozilla

WebI have 96 objects in an array in the component's state after a fetch. They are all unique objects except for the year and in some cases the month. The year can not be set statically because it will obviously change at some point. The months will be converted from an Integer to a String. WebJun 29, 2010 · You can do this using System.Web.Helpers.Json - its Decode method returns a dynamic object which you can traverse as you like. It's included in the System.Web.Helpers assembly (.NET 4.0). var dynamicObject = Json.Decode (jsonString); Share Improve this answer Follow edited Apr 15, 2013 at 10:19 answered Feb 29, 2012 … smallest towns in texas to live

.net - Deserialize JSON into C# dynamic object? - Stack Overflow

Category:Deconstructing tuples and other types Microsoft Learn

Tags:Cannot deconstruct dynamic objects

Cannot deconstruct dynamic objects

Anonymous Types Microsoft Learn

WebIntroduction to the JavaScript object destructuring assignment. Suppose you have a person object with two properties: firstName and lastName. let person = { firstName: 'John' , lastName: 'Doe' }; Code language: JavaScript (javascript) Prior to ES6, when you want to assign properties of the person object to variables, you typically do it like this: WebDec 11, 2024 · A destructor function is called automatically when the object goes out of scope: (1) the function ends (2) the program ends (3) a block containing local variables ends (4) a delete operator is called Note: destructor can also be called explicitly for an object. syntax: object_name.~class_name ()

Cannot deconstruct dynamic objects

Did you know?

WebMar 11, 2016 · But, I have found a small and effective solution to destructure any objects dynamically. you can destructure them in two ways. But both ways are has done the same action. Ex: const user = { id: 42, displayName: "jdoe", fullName: { firstName: "John", lastName: "Doe" } }; using "Object.key", "forEach" and "window" object. WebDec 12, 2024 · Wont work if deconstruct is an extension method. Nothing that can be done about this I guess - it's a general limitation of dynamic. Won't work on valueTuple. Two …

WebSep 20, 2024 · As per the compiler error message, you can't use deconstruction with dynamic values. In this case you know that your method is going to return a tuple, so either cast the result to that: (result, errorList) = ( (string, List)) d.MyMethod … WebDec 4, 2024 · As soon as a dynamic is in the mix the compiler defers evaluation of the entire expression until runtime, including the call to makeTuple. As a result the return value of …

WebYes, with Dynamic Imports To add to Bergi's answer which addresses static imports, note that in the case of dynamic imports, since the returned module is an object, you can use destructuring assignment to import it: (async function () { const { default: { foo, bar } } = await import ('./export-file.js'); console.log (foo, bar); }) (); WebMay 27, 2024 · Here’s a breakdown (or build up) to my object, with destructuring along the way. One JavaScript Object For the simplest object (like I outlined above when defining destructuring), it looks like this: const myObject = { props: 'Hello world' }; The destructured version becomes: const { props } = myObject; console.log (props); // prints: 'Hello world'

Webfor resolving this you have two way: 1) Use explicit type instead of var: ExpandoObject result = ... 2) cast the result when you are passing it to Remove: Data.Remove ( (ExpandoObject) result) I think with doing one of these ways, your problem will resolve. good luck. Share.

WebDec 12, 2024 · Wont work if deconstruct is an extension method. Nothing that can be done about this I guess - it's a general limitation of dynamic. Won't work on valueTuple. Two … smallest towns in nyWebSep 28, 2024 · For more information about deconstruction of tuples and other types, see Deconstructing tuples and other types. Tuple equality. Tuple types support the == and != operators. These operators compare members of the left-hand operand with the corresponding members of the right-hand operand following the order of tuple elements. smallest towns in texas under 500 peopleWebFeb 24, 2024 · dynamic d = new Test(); // Variables we want to deconstruct into string text; int number; // Approach 1: Casting (text, number) = ((string, int)) d.Method(); // Approach 2: Assign to a tuple variable first (string, int) tuple = d.Method(); (text, number) = tuple; } song old town road meaningWebFeb 7, 2024 · It would set a new product object although it would just rewrite the whole content of the object with the only the most recent entered input. I then attempted a different approach with an interface where: interface IProduct { name: string; price: string; stock: string; } const [product, setProduct] = React.useState smallest towns in the worldWebMay 24, 2024 · In the following code, the activeObject will be set true if it is undefined in this.props. Const {active, activeStatus, activeObject = true } = this.props. 3. Using the Re-assigning method: A variable name that is not a copy of the property being destructured may be used. This is achieved by reassigning as shown below. song old time road billy ray cyrusWebAug 11, 2016 · Calling ~T () is exactly how std::vector handles the problem. Firstly, push_back needs to use placement new to copy-construct the value into the vector. You can't just use assignment. Secondly, you can't call realloc - if the object have internal pointers, they are going to end up pointing outside them selves. smallest towns in pennsylvaniaWeb12. Destructuring the nested object is clean and short but sucks when source property is null or undefined in right side object. let say we have. const { loading, data: { getPosts }, } = useQuery (FETCH_POSTS_QUERY); Solution 1 if we have data object but no getPosts then we can use: (Setting default at each level) smallest towns in nj